It was discovered that libgphoto2 did not properly validate buffer boundaries when parsing EOS image format data.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to obtain sensitive information. (CVE-2026-40333) It was discovered that libgphoto2 did not properly null-terminate buffers when parsing Canon folder entries.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to obtain sensitive information. (CVE-2026-40334) It was discovered that libgphoto2 did not properly validate buffer boundaries when parsing device property values.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to obtain sensitive information. (CVE-2026-40335) It was discovered that libgphoto2 had a memory leak when parsing Sony device property descriptors.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to cause a denial of service. This issue only affected Ubuntu 26.04 LTS. (CVE-2026-40336) It was discovered that libgphoto2 did not properly validate buffer boundaries when parsing Sony device property enumeration data.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to obtain sensitive information. (CVE-2026-40338) It was discovered that libgphoto2 did not properly validate buffer boundaries when parsing Sony device property form flags.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to obtain sensitive information. (CVE-2026-40339) It was discovered that libgphoto2 did not properly validate buffer boundaries when parsing object information.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to obtain sensitive information. (CVE-2026-40340) It was discovered that libgphoto2 did not properly validate buffer boundaries when parsing EOS focus information. An attacker with physical access could possibly use this issue to cause libgphoto2 to crash, resulting in a denial of service. (CVE-2026-40341)
